Taxonomy Alkaloids and derivatives > Hasubanan alkaloids
IUPAC Name 3,4,11,12-tetramethoxy-17-methyl-17-azatetracyclo[8.4.3.01,10.02,7]heptadeca-2(7),3,5,11-tetraen-13-one
SMILES (Canonical) CN1CCC23C1(CCC4=C2C(=C(C=C4)OC)OC)C(=C(C(=O)C3)OC)OC
SMILES (Isomeric) CN1CCC23C1(CCC4=C2C(=C(C=C4)OC)OC)C(=C(C(=O)C3)OC)OC
InChI InChI=1S/C21H27NO5/c1-22-11-10-20-12-14(23)17(25-3)19(27-5)21(20,22)9-8-13-6-7-15(24-2)18(26-4)16(13)20/h6-7H,8-12H2,1-5H3
InChI Key DXUSNRCTWFHYFS-UHFFFAOYSA-N

Physical and Chemical Properties

Top
Molecular Formula C21H27NO5
Molecular Weight 373.40 g/mol
Exact Mass 373.18892296 g/mol
Topological Polar Surface Area (TPSA) 57.20 Ų
XlogP 2.10
Atomic LogP (AlogP) 2.44
H-Bond Acceptor 6
H-Bond Donor 0
Rotatable Bonds 4

Plants that contains it

Top
Below are displayed all the plants proven (via scientific papers) to contain this compound!
To see more specific details click the taxa you are interested in.
Cephalotaxus fortunei
Cephalotaxus hainanensis
Stephania elegans
Stephania japonica
